INTRODUCTIONanada's experience with the interpretation of bilingual laws goes back a long way.For example, the Civil Code of Lower Canada, which came into force in 1866, contained a provision to guide interpreters in the resolution of problems caused by differences in the French and English versions of the Code. 1 Canadian courts have established a method for dealing with problems of interpretation of bilingual laws by building on the experience of many generations of jurists.Anyone wishing to become familiar with the interpretive method would normally turn to a textbook on statutory interpretation, like my colleague Ruth Sullivan's excellent fourth edition of Elmer Driedger's Construction of Statutes.2 Professor Sullivan provides an accurate description of the way bilingual statutes ought to be interpreted, based on numerous judicial dicta and decisions, most from the Supreme Court of Canada
